Anne Slaughter Andrew
Takes Head Of US Embassy Today.
Anne Slaughter Andrew today officially
replaces Peter Cianchette as head of the
United States Embassy in San José.
Cianchette left his post in June 2009,
leaving the San José embassy without a boss
for the last six months.
Like her most recent predecessor, Anne has
no diplomatic experience, her experiences
have been in environment and alternative
energy, leaving her position a the Principal
of New Energy Nexus, LLC, that advises
companies and entrepreneurs on investments
and strategies to capitalize on the New
Energy Economy.
Anne graduated from Georgetown University
with a Bachelor of Arts and received her
Juris Doctorate from Indiana University
School of Law-Indianapolis, where she served
as Editor in-Chief of the Indiana Law
Review.
Anne is wife of Joseph Andrew, who was
National Chairman of the Democratic National
Committee (DNC) from 1999–2001, who during
the 2008 Democratic Presidential nominating
contest he was one of the first to endorse
Senator Hillary Clinton in November 2007.
However, on May 1, 2008, however, he
switched his endorsement from Clinton to
Senator Barack Obama.
